Maggie’s memorial is at the Old Burying Ground (Quadra St.), along with other sailors from the Sutlej who were lost at sea in South America. (I’d attach a photo but it was 3 computers ago and I’ll just need to go take a new one…) 😁
Indigenous History Month day 2: whatever happened to ‘Maggie Sutlej?’ One of the first documented #MMIWG from Vancouver Island. Read the account from her Ahousaht relatives, here: hashilthsa.com/news/2023-01...

It’s Indigenous History Month! Remember to give extra love to your Indigenous friends/colleagues who are taking on extra work this month. Whether providing additional education or feeling more “on display,” the burden of emotional, mental and intellectual labour gets more skewed in June. ❤️💪🏼
